Pharai (Greek Φαραί, also Φηραί Pherai ) was an ancient Greek, situated on Nedon city in southern Messenia. Tonight's Kalamata is located on the spot.

Pharai is mentioned by Homer. The area of the city was devastated by the 394 BC Athenian Conon strategists. At the latest by King Philip II of Macedon came to the city of Messinia. From 182 BC Pharai was a member of the Achaean League and was a collar formerly laconic places, the so-called Eleutherolakones assigned by Emperor Augustus. From the ancient city of only small remnants remain.
